Wicca is a modern pagan witchcraft tradition that incorporates nature-based spirituality and magic. One aspect of practicing Wicca involves casting spells to manifest desires and bring about desired outcomes. A Wiccan spell guide provides instructions and information on how to perform spells effectively. Wiccan spells are typically focused on personal growth, healing, protection, love, and abundance. They often involve the use of tools such as candles, crystals, herbs, and incense to enhance the energy and intention of the practitioner. The guide may provide information on the specific tools and ingredients needed for each spell, as well as their correspondences and symbolic meanings.

Hi there. Thank you for reaching out. If you don't connect to the network for one month, DJI Fly App will be logged out automatically after one month, and a re-login is required. We highly recommend checking the app every time before flying to ensure the stability of the mission. Thank you for your understanding and support.

Thank you for your response. To ensure flight safety, the FlySafe Database will be updated from time to time, which requires users to connect to the Internet. Thus, a prompt for account login is displayed to remind the user to connect to the network. No worries, we will forward this feedback of yours to our relevant team for attention. As Wiccan spells often involve the use of words or chants, a spell guide may also provide examples of incantations or invocations that can be used for specific purposes. These spells may be written in rhyme or poetry-like form to enhance their effectiveness and create a rhythmic flow of energy. Furthermore, a Wiccan spell guide may emphasize the importance of ethical spell casting. Wiccans believe in the principle of "harm none," which means that spells should not be used to manipulate or harm others. The guide may provide guidance on how to ensure that spells are aligned with this ethical principle and promote positive intentions.
